U.S. Navy Lt. Tya Rowe talks about the Community Health Engagement team's role before Cobra Gold 2020, at Wat Dong Khoi School in Phitsanulok, Thailand, Feb. 18, 2020. Cobra Gold 20 maintains a consistent focus on Humanitarian Civic Action, community engagement, and medical activities conducted during the exercise to support the needs and humanitarian interests of civilian populations around the region.
